ABSTRACT:
A method for selecting packets to be switched in a collapsed virtual output queuing array (cVOQ) switch core, using a request/acknowledge mechanism is disclosed. An egress location for an ingress port is selected based on degrees of freedom for the selection mechanism. The degree of freedom can be derived from the collapsed virtual output queuing array by determining a number of egress locations to which an ingress port may send packets and determining a number of ingress ports from which an egress location can receive packets. Analyzing all the queued packets for assignment to an egress location, starting with a lesser degree of freedom and ending with a greater degree of freedom provides efficient switching allocations and acknowledgements.
